Output 787a623b8bec55eb2693f1269be42e80eed423a7343de0f3df44f07aa941ac66:0

value
17497392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 978b49d16a9e2e015da8412ec435a00b4d0cc1e4 OP_EQUALVERIFY OP_CHECKSIG
address
1EpHttfRxRNjdkxs7Z4wkvbA71wSvfvcx6
transaction
787a623b8bec55eb2693f1269be42e80eed423a7343de0f3df44f07aa941ac66
confirmations
443759
spent
true